When the dew point is below 0o C Which of the following is likely to form?

If the air and the surface cools to the dew point, the temperature at which saturation occurs, dew forms. If the air temperature drops below freezing, the dew will freeze becoming frozen dew. If the dew point is less that 0C, then we refer to it as the frost point, and frost forms by deposition.

What is the dome of water associated with a hurricane called?

A storm surge is a large dome of water, 50 to 100 miles. wide, that sweeps across the coastline near where a. hurricane makes landfall.

What happens when the dew point is reached?

When air has reached the dew-point temperature at a particular pressure, the water vapor in the air is in equilibrium with liquid water, meaning water vapor is condensing at the same rate at which liquid water is evaporating.

When the air temperature reaches the dew point what happens to the relative humidity of the air mass?

Once the air temperature and dew point meet, the air becomes saturated and the relative humidity reaches 100%.

What happens when two air masses meet?

When two different air masses come into contact, they don't mix. They push against each other along a line called a front. When a warm air mass meets a cold air mass, the warm air rises since it is lighter. At high altitude it cools, and the water vapor it contains condenses.

What happens when a cold front meets a warm front?

An occluded front forms when a cold front reaches a warm front, forcing all the warm air to rise to higher altitudes and the cold air is stratified near the ground.

Is there an eye of a tornado?

There is no “eye” to a tornado like there is in a hurricane. This is a fiction largely caused by the movie Twister. Tornadoes are complex and can have multiple small structures called “sub vortices” rotating inside the larger parent circulation.

Can you stay in the eye of a hurricane?

It's not entirely uncommon for people in the eye of a hurricane to assume the storm has passed and think it's safe to go outside. People caught in the eye need to continue sheltering in place and, if anything, prepare for the worst. Circling the center eye are the eyewall winds, the strongest in the hurricane.

What happens when temperature and dew point are close together?

Relative Humidity can be inferred from dew point values. When air temperature and dew point temperatures are very close, the air has a high relative humidity. The opposite is true when there is a large difference between air and dew point temperatures, which indicates air with lower relaitve humidity.

When dew point is reached precipitation will occur True or false?

If the relative humidity is 100 percent (i.e., dewpoint temperature and actual air temperature are the same), this does NOT necessarily mean that precipitation will occur. It simply means that the maximum amount of moisture is in the air at the particular temperature the air is at.

What is formed when two air masses collide?

So when two different air masses meet a boundary is formed. The boundary between two air masses is called a front. Weather at a front is usually cloudy and stormy. There are four different fronts- Cold Warm Stationary and Occluded.

Can you breathe inside a tornado?

Researchers estimate that the density of the air would be 20% lower than what's found at high altitudes. To put this in perspective, breathing in a tornado would be equivalent to breathing at an altitude of 8,000 m (26,246.72 ft). At that level, you generally need assistance to be able to breathe.

Is it calm inside a tornado?

Single-vortex tornadoes (tornadoes that consist of a single column of air rotating around a center) are theorized to have a calm or nearly calm "eye," an area of relatively low wind speed near the center of the vortex.

Can an airplane fly over a hurricane?

Can a plane fly over a hurricane? Yes, it is possible to overfly a hurricane while staying away from the storm. Pilots check carefully for reports or forecast of turbulence when coordinating with flight dispatchers for selecting the route.

Can submarines go under hurricanes?

Normally, a submerged submarine will not rock with the motion of the waves on the surface. It is only in the most violent hurricanes and cyclones that wave motion reaches as much as 400 feet below the surface. In these conditions, submarines can take a five to ten-degree roll.

What happens when air reaches its dew point quizlet?

What happens when air that has reached its dew point is cooled further? Once air is cooled further than the dew point, they become clouds, fog, or dew because the overflow of water vapor "condenses."

What causes high dew point?

The dew point is affected by humidity. When there is more moisture in the air, the dew point is higher. When the temperature is below the freezing point of water, the dew point is called the frost point, as frost is formed via deposition rather than condensation.

What happens when two wind fronts converge?

Convergence: When two air masses of the same temperature collide and neither is willing to go back down, the only way to go is up. As the name implies, the two winds converge and rise together in an updraft that often leads to cloud formation.
